Mulan 2 product reviews

The spirited Mulan gets the thrill of her life when General Shang asks for her hand in marriage, but the surprises are just beginning. Throwing a wrench into their plans is the mischievous Mushu, who tries to keep the happy couple apart as long as possible in order to retain his job as her guardian dragon.

Adding to their adventure is the fact that Mulan and Shang must escort three princesses across China to their own arranged marriages. When she discovers that these three women aren't looking forward to their upcoming weddings, Mulan makes a bold decision that will change the course of history.

DVD Special Features:
Deleted Scenes, Voices Of Mulan, The World Of Mulan Hosted By Mushu, Mushu's Guess Who Game.

The adventures continue. Fa Mulan is now a Hero of China, and the star of her village. Her relationship with now-General Shang is ready to progress when he proposes marriage... but as the saying goes, opposites attract. Mulan and Shang are like the Sun the Rain, each unlike the other in very fundamental ways, but without the other, nothing will grow between them.

Mushu is the same old Mushu, always looking out for himself in his 500-year goal to reclaim his pedestal and return to duty as one of the Family Guardians. Even if that means destroying the budding relationship of Mulan and Sheng.

A great tale, well told and with the consistantly stunning artwork form Disney's finest artists. A little more of a musical too, with *4* couples by the end of it.

Our 4 1/2 year old test audience was quite taken with it, and gave it his personal seal, the '4 replays in a row' of approval.

Overall, another winner for Disney.
